Sewer Repair in Naperville, IL
Sewer repair services address issues with a property's underground sewer lines, which are essential for directing wastewater away from the home. These services typically cover a range of projects, including fixing broken or cracked pipes, clearing blockages, replacing damaged sections, and addressing tree root intrusion. Homeowners often seek sewer repairs when experiencing persistent backups, foul odors, slow drains, or visible signs of a sewer problem on their property. Understanding the scope of the repair needed and the potential causes of sewer line issues can help property owners make informed decisions before requesting service.
Before requesting sewer repair, property owners should consider the location and accessibility of the sewer lines, as well as the age and condition of existing plumbing systems. It’s helpful to know if there have been recent plumbing inspections or if there are any known issues with the sewer system. Clarifying the extent of the damage and understanding the different repair options available can ensure that the necessary work is completed effectively and efficiently, minimizing disruption to the property.

Common Sewer Repair Jobs
Sewer Line Replacement - involves removing and installing new sewer pipes to ensure proper flow.
Sewer Line Repair - addresses cracks, leaks, or blockages in existing sewer lines.
Drain Line Clearing - removes clogs and debris from main sewer and drain pipes.
Pipe Locating - uses specialized tools to accurately identify underground sewer line locations.
Video Sewer Inspection - utilizes cameras to diagnose issues inside sewer pipes without invasive digging.
Emergency Sewer Services - provides prompt assistance for sudden sewer backups or failures.
Sewer Repair Questions
What are common signs of sewer problems? Indicators include persistent odors, slow drains, gurgling sounds, or sewage backups in the property.
How is sewer repair typically performed? Repairs often involve locating the issue, then using methods like pipe lining or excavation to fix or replace damaged sections.
Can sewer repairs be done without extensive digging? Yes, trenchless methods can repair or replace sewer lines with minimal disruption to the property.
